Left with no references after being sacked by her lecherous employer, Danielle Dulac is out of options. So, when Anthony Markham, enigmatic Duke of Blackmoor, offers to hire her as governess to his four-year-old son, despite a niggling little voice telling her to run, she accepts.

A notorious rake, the Duke is surly, sarcastic, embittered, and hostile. And the most sensuous man Danielle has ever met. The attraction between them is instantaneous, combustible...and forbidden. Governesses do not fall in love with Dukes.

She soon discovers that the Master of Blackmoor is haunted by a dark and tragic past filled with lies, betrayal and death. Unfortunately, the past is not over. Evil stalks Blackmoor Hall. The danger is escalating and all the clues point to the Duke himself.

As the passion between Anthony and Danielle rages out of control, so does the peril they face. Will they uncover the evil in time? Or will it destroy them both?
